iPhone 8 Plus 64GB

The 5.5-inch iPhone 8 Plus is quite similar to its predecessor 7 Plus version with the notable exception that the back side is made out of glass. Wireless charging technology based upon the Qi-standard requires a transparent material like glass in order to properly work.



The exterior of iPhone 8 Plus as well as the smaller iPhone 8 also look similar to iPhone 7 Plus' including a fingerprint scanner and a home button. It also sports a Retina-screen. The new True Tone technology, however, improves colour rendering and increases the range of colours that the phone can display.


Dual-rear 12 MP cameras mean that the new iPhone 8 takes higher-quality photos. Furthermore, recording in slow motion at a frame rate of 240 fps in 1080p is double that of iPhone 7. 


The phone is powered by Apple’s A11 processor, which contains a neural system capable of face-recognition (currently only available on iPhone X). It lacks a headphone jack and is waterproof.


The operating system employed is the new iOS 11.

Both the 8 and 8 Plus use Apple's new A11 Bionic processor, a hexa-core chip with two performance cores that are 25-percent faster than the A10, and four performance cores that the company says are 70-percent faster than the old model.
